Factors Affecting Weight Gain
Several factors influence weight gain, including genetics, metabolism, and calorie intake. Genetics play a role in determining your body type and how easily you gain weight. Metabolism refers to the rate at which your body burns calories for energy. A higher metabolism may make it more challenging to gain weight. Caloric intake is another significant factor, as consuming more calories than you burn will result in weight gain.
Setting Realistic Weight Gain Goals
Setting realistic weight gain goals is essential to ensure you stay on track and maintain a healthy approach. It’s advisable to aim for a gradual weight gain of 1-2 pounds per week. This gradual approach allows your body to adapt to the changes and prevents excessive fat gain.

Strength Training for Muscle Gain
Strength training exercises, such as weightlifting, are essential for gaining muscle mass. Focus on compound exercises that target multiple muscle groups, such as squats, deadlifts, bench presses, and shoulder presses. These exercises stimulate muscle growth and promote weight gain.
Effective Weightlifting Techniques
To maximize muscle growth, use proper weightlifting techniques. Lift weights that are challenging enough to cause muscle fatigue within 8-12 repetitions. Gradually increase the weight over time to ensure progressive overload and continuous muscle growth.
Importance of Progressive Overload
To see consistent muscle gain, it’s crucial to incorporate progressive overload into your strength training routine. Progressive overload refers to gradually increasing the demands placed on your muscles to stimulate further growth. This can be achieved by increasing the weight, volume, or intensity of your workouts over time.

Eating Habits to Promote Weight Gain
In addition to focusing on your diet, certain eating habits can help promote weight gain and maximize nutrient absorption.
Eating Frequent and Regular Meals
Eating frequent and regular meals throughout the day can help increase your caloric intake. Aim for three main meals and two to three snacks in between. This approach ensures that you are consistently providing your body with the necessary nutrients for weight gain.
Snacking between Meals
Snacking between meals can be an effective way to add extra calories and nutrients to your diet. Choose healthy, calorie-dense snacks such as nuts, nut butter, granola bars, yogurt, and dried fruits.
Maximizing Nutrient Absorption
To maximize nutrient absorption, focus on consuming whole foods rather than processed or refined options. Whole foods are r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als that support overall health and weight gain.
Avoiding Empty Calorie Foods
While it’s important to increase calorie intake for weight gain, avoid relying solely on empty calorie foods. These include sugary snacks, fast food, and processed snacks that lack nutritional value. Instead, opt for nutrient-dense options that provide essential vitamins and minerals.
Hydrating Properly
Staying hydrated is crucial for overall health and weight gain. Drink water throughout the day and include hydrating foods such as fruits and vegetables in your diet. Avoid excessive consumption of sugary beverages and alcohol, as they can contribute to empty calories.
